Types of Cots Available
There are a number of kinds of cots readily available, each with its own unique features and benefits. Below is a summary of the most typical types.
1. Standard Cots
These standard cots are created to accommodate a baby from infancy up until they have to do with 2 to 3 years old. Requirement cots normally include adjustable mattress heights.
Benefits:Sturdy buildingComes with various style alternativesOften transforms to young child beds2. Portable Cots
Portable cots are a flexible option for moms and dads who take a trip often or have actually limited space. These lightweight cribs are easy to set up and can be taken apart for transportation.
Advantages:Easy to moveAppropriate for travelOften light-weight and retractable3. Convertible Cots
Convertible cots are developed to grow with your child. They can change from a crib to a young child bed and even into a full-size bed, making them a long-lasting financial investment.
Advantages:Long-lastingCost-efficientVersatile style choices4. Co-Sleeping Cots
Co-sleeping cots attach to the side of a moms and dad's bed, enabling simple access while keeping the baby in a separate sleep area. This option promotes bonding and convenience for nighttime feedings.
Benefits:Facilitates simple nighttime gain access toPromotes bondingLowers danger of rolling over onto the baby5. Bassinets
Bassinets are smaller sleeping areas specifically designed for babies. Ideal for newborns, they frequently come with a portable style and are light-weight.

When shopping for cots, moms and dads ought to keep the following features in mind:

Safety Standards: Ensure the cot satisfies security regulations, as this is critical for your kid's health and wellbeing. Try to find cots that abide by standards set by relevant authorities.

Product: Choose cots made from non-toxic, resilient products. Solid wood cots are generally stronger than those made from composite products.

Adjustable Mattress Height: Cots with adjustable mattress heights allow you to reduce the bed mattress as your baby grows and becomes more mobile, boosting security by preventing falls.

Relieve of Assembly: Look for cots that feature clear assembly instructions, and consider the tools you'll need to put them together.

Design and Style: Cots can be found in various styles, colors, and designs to fit the total style of your nursery. Choose one that complements your home decoration.
Tips for Choosing the Right Cot
Identify Your Budget: Cots can range considerably in rate. Establish a budget that considers both the cot's expense and any additional costs (e.g., bed mattress, bed linen).

Read Reviews: Before purchasing, read customer evaluations to gain insight into the cot's security, durability, and ease of usage.

Test Stability: If possible, physically examine the cot in-store or check the specs online. A steady cot should not wobble and should have safe joints.

Consider Space: Measure the area where you prepare to position the cot to make sure an appropriate fit without crowding the room.

Strategy for the Future: Consider how long you expect to use the cot and whether it can adapt to your kid's needs as they grow.
